The Financial Strain on Strategy’s Bitcoin Holdings

Strategy’s bold approach to accumulating Bitcoin under the leadership of Michael Saylor has brought the company to an unprecedented situation. As the biggest corporate purchaser of Bitcoin, it has invested approximately $5.3 billion since the start of 2025. However, with Bitcoin crashing below its recent purchase price range of $95,000 to $105,000, the corporation now reports a staggering $3.86 billion in unrealized losses. This situation raises critical questions about the sustainability of such a position and the ensuing impact on investor confidence.

Market Dynamics and Implications for Institutional Investors

The marked decline in Bitcoin’s value—over 13% in 2025 alone—highlights the inherent risks associated with cryptocurrency investments, particularly for institutions like Strategy. Despite recent price fluctuations, many in the market remain optimistic about a recovery based on past performance. However, technical indicators suggest that further declines to the $50,000-$60,000 range are possible, which would jeopardize the viability of Strategy’s holdings relative to its average cost basis. Such a scenario could lead the company to consider drastic measures, including potential liquidations.

Investor Sentiment: A Double-Edged Sword

While some investors hold out hope for Bitcoin’s resurgence, an underlying complacency pervades the market affecting both retail and institutional players. This belief, that markets will bounce back simply because they have historically done so, could be detrimental. If Strategy were to shift its position due to ongoing losses, it could trigger a domino effect throughout the cryptocurrency market, further exacerbating volatility and driving prices even lower.

Future Outlook for Strategy and Bitcoin

As we look ahead, the trajectory of Strategy’s Bitcoin investment strategy remains uncertain. The company has not publicly indicated a change in its holding policy; however, ongoing market strains could force a reassessment of their strategy. Without a recovery in Bitcoin prices, the firm may face increased pressure to either hold firm or sell, which would likely impact market sentiment significantly.
